Redis集群是多台Redis服务器的集合,它为开发人员提供了可靠的存储和实时访问可扩展数据的机制。了解Redis集群的关键知识,能以无缝的方式管理大规模的数据存储,可以帮助我们构建复杂的数据解决方案。
我们提供的服务有:成都网站制作、成都做网站、微信公众号开发、网站优化、网站认证、江陵ssl等。为成百上千家企事业单位解决了网站和推广的问题。提供周到的售前咨询和贴心的售后服务,是有科学管理、有技术的江陵网站制作公司
为了有效地管理Redis集群,必须首先了解它的一些基本原则和组件:
Redis集群由多个Redis服务器组成,它们共同构建了数据库;
Redis集群支持分片存储技术,可以将大量数据存储到多台服务器中;
Redis集群有两个主要的功能,一个是可扩展性,另一个是灾难恢复;
Redis集群使用一种称为“Sentinel”的动态节点管理系统,这种系统能自动查找和根据节点状态位置调整节点位置;
Redis集群能像普通的Redis服务器一样,它也支持基本的Redis编程接口。
另外,为了更好地解决读写性能和可用性的问题,Redis集群也支持一些高级功能,比如:
数据分片技术:通过将数据预先分片,可以将数据分布在多台服务器,从而提高读写性能;
高可用:通过采用Sentinel管理系统,Redis集群可以实现自动恢复和负载均衡;
数据副本:通过创建副本,可以有效地保护数据安全性,防止数据丢失;
强一致性:Redis集群采用强一致性策略,将原子性命令保持在集群中;
Redis集群也可以使用客户端SDK加载均衡,将数据写入到集群中:
//我们要创建一个客户端实例
RedisCluster cluster = new RedisCluster("127.0.0.1");
//然后,使用客户端SDK,将数据写入到Redis集群中
cluster.set("key", "value");
//可以使用客户端实例从集群中读取数据
String value = cluster.get("key");
从上面的知识总结来看,Redis集群的应用非常广泛,在一些涉及大量数据存储和实时访问的应用场景中,Redis集群能提供可靠、高效、安全的解决方案。因此,Redis集群绝对值得深入学习。
成都创新互联建站主营:成都网站建设、网站维护、网站改版的网站建设公司,提供成都网站制作、成都网站建设、成都网站推广、成都网站优化seo、响应式移动网站开发制作等网站服务。
分享文章:Redis集群值得深入学习的知识总结(redis集群知识总结)
文章链接:http://www.csdahua.cn/qtweb/news37/555587.html
网站建设、网络推广公司-快上网,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 快上网